Usage Note 23435: In ODS HTML output, how can I reduce the area for the table of contents within the frame file?
The CONTENTSIZE= attribute determines what percentage
of the frame file is used for
the table of contents. Specify this attribute within
the style element Frame. You can also reduce the fonts
so that the table
is smaller. View output.
proc template;
define style styles.test;
parent=styles.default;
style Frame from Document /
contentposition = L
bodyscrollbar = auto
bodysize = *
contentscrollbar = auto
contentsize = 5%
framespacing = 1
frameborderwidth = 4
frameborder = on;
end;
run;
